Caleb Martin will have the opportunity to continue his career with the Miami Heat. As reported by Shams Charania of The Athletic, the 25-year-old forward has signed a two-way contract with the Florida franchise, thus changing his scene after two courses at Charlotte Hornets.
Without being chosen in the 2019 draft, Martin ended up joining the North Carolina organization, where he has shared a dressing room with his brother Cody Martin. There he enjoyed up to 53 games in the 2020-21 campaign to average 5 points, 2.7 rebounds and 1.3 assists in 15.4 minutes per night.
